David Wiley posts about fully distributing the social network. This basically means empowering blogs or other personal Web sites to make the connections directly, without a centralized service such as Facebook.  One of the ideas that makes this work is URLs are people, too

Standards like OpenID, XFN, and  hCard can be used to tie all of this together.  The DISO-Project is working on the code to make this happen now. They are starting by building on Wordpress, but any Web platform should be able to support these formats.
